Output 663ff1d801a922346d9087338f82437c480a4b5837aa4daaf9e30433c9f34bfb:0

value
857631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1434c89666182a8d2568b54694e2814384f0cf OP_EQUAL
address
3PV9dLmU1fNBb3XA975igfn73i95SSAqqW
transaction
663ff1d801a922346d9087338f82437c480a4b5837aa4daaf9e30433c9f34bfb
confirmations
170462
spent
true